What is Psychiatry?

Psychiatry is a medical specialized that focuses on the assessment, diagnosis, treatment, and avoidance of mental illness, emotional disturbances, and inefficient behaviors. Psychiatrists, who are doctors specialized in this field, make use of a vast array of techniques to deal with patients, including medications, psychiatric therapy, and neighborhood support. Their extensive training in both medication and mental health distinctively positions them to deal with the intricate biological, psychological, and social factors that add to mental health problems.

Typical Types of Mental Disorders

Mental conditions can manifest in various forms, and comprehending their categories is vital for efficient treatment. Below is a table summing up a few of the most common types:

Type of DisorderDescriptionExamples
Mood DisordersConditions that mainly impact a person's emotion.Major depressive condition, bipolar affective disorder
Stress and anxiety DisordersCharacterized by extreme worry or stress and anxiety.Generalized anxiety condition, panic attack, social stress and anxiety condition
Psychotic DisordersConditions that impact the mind's understanding of reality, causing significant impairments.Schizophrenia, quick psychotic disorder
Character DisordersEnduring patterns of habits, cognition, and inner experience that differ cultural expectations.Borderline personality disorder, narcissistic character condition
Consuming DisordersDisorders defined by abnormal or disrupted eating habits.Anorexia nervosa, bulimia nervosa

Diagnostic Processes in Psychiatry

Psychiatrists utilize a variety of diagnostic tools and methods to understand a client's mental health condition:

  1. Clinical Interview: This is typically the initial step, where the psychiatrist collects in-depth information about the client's history, signs, and behaviors.

  2. Mental Testing: Various standardized tests can assist in more assessing state of mind, cognition, and personality type.

  3. Health examination: Sometimes, physical health issues can manifest as psychiatric signs; hence, a thorough medical checkup is essential.

  4. Observation: Monitoring a patient's behavior with time can supply vital insights.

Treatment Modalities

As soon as a diagnosis is established, there are a number of avenues for treatment that psychiatrists might consider:

Psychotherapy

Psychiatric therapy, also referred to as talk therapy, is a main method utilized to treat different mental illness. Here are some typical types:

  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Focuses on recognizing and changing unfavorable thinking patterns.
  • Social Therapy (IPT): Addresses concerns in personal relationships that might affect mental health.
  •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): A type of CBT that stresses emotional guideline and social effectiveness, often utilized for borderline personality condition.

Pharmacotherapy

Psychiatrists might recommend medication to assist reduce symptoms. Some typical types consist of:

  • Antidepressants: Used for state of mind conditions (e.g., SSRIs like fluoxetine).
  • Antipsychotics: Treat psychotic disorders (e.g., aripiprazole).
  • State of mind Stabilizers: Used for bipolar affective disorder (e.g., lithium).

Alternative and Complementary Therapies

In addition to conventional methods, patients might check out options such as:

  • Mindfulness and Meditation: Helps to lower tension and enhance emotional awareness.
  • Nutritional Therapy: Focuses on the benefits of a well balanced diet on mental health.
  • Workout: Regular exercise can improve state of mind and reduce anxiety.
